    Abstract:

    The dam site of the Qingshui River Panghai navigation and power junction project is in narrow river section of mountainous area without the working condition that ship lock and factory building are both constructing at the same time.Combining with the characteristics of large flood discharge in mountainous river,short duration of flood and high ratio of flood to dry water,we fully consider the principle of early commissioning of power generation of factory buildings,and propose the design scheme to adopt staggered diversion and overflow cofferdam.In the first stage of the design scheme,we enclose factory building of power station and part of the sluice.In the second stage,we adopt the discharge method of the overflow cofferdam and the built sluice at the same time.We establish a 1100 normal fixed bed physical model of the dam section to verify the diversion effect of the design scheme.The results show that the design indexes of scheme can meet the requirements.It can provide the conferences for the similar projects.
